Du Bois and Ambedkar, both intellectually sound personalities, challenged the established institutions of oppression of race and caste. Their intellectual and social legacies continue to have an impact on academia and society today. Their new interpretations of history changed the course of generations. This paper, using an intellectual historical method, attempts to revisit and analyse the issues of “race” and “caste” and the relevance of interpretations by both intellectuals. AbstractThis article analyses the historical conditions for, and implications of, the attitudes and conduct of a number of prominent or influential public intellectuals in the United States during the Great War. It argues that many intellectuals, particularly those who supported American entry to the war, shared a general lack of concern with the realities of full-scale warfare. Their response to the war had little to do with the war itself – its political and economic causes, brutal and industrial character, and human and material costs. This thesis discusses three intellectuals, each from a distinct academic background, and their relationship with National Socialism. Persons covered are Carl Gustav Jung, Martin Heidegger, and Eugen Fischer. This thesis aims at discovering something common and fundamental about the intellectuals' relationship to politics as such. The relationship each had with National Socialism is evaluated with an eye to their distinct academic backgrounds. In the decades prior to the Revolution of 1917, the Russian intelligencija was strongly influenced by Western European intellectuals, including Friedrich Nietzsche. Nietzsche was one of the European philosophers who played a prominent role in shaping Russian perceptions of reality in this period, although his thought was interpreted by Russians in contrasing ways. The article examines the case of Dmitrij Merežkovskij, reassessing the extent of Nietzsche’s influence on his oeuvre. In our view, Nietzsche did not only influence Merežkovskij’s early poetry, where aesthetic and anti-Christian views prevail, but also contributed to the sensual and individualist nature of his later prose.

The medieval approach to work was ambivalent, influenced by conflicting cultural legacies, as seen in the tripartite society and tensions between labour and ascetic ideals. The text explores medieval labour contracts, emphasising nuanced relations between servitude, subordination, and freedom, both in rural and urban context, highlighting evolving worker statuses in guilds. Medieval views on mechanical arts challenged Greco-Roman disdain, with intellectuals reconciling manual arts with divine wisdom, reshaping perceptions of practical skills. Societal changes, including city growth and merchant inclusion, challenged traditional orders: a new human perspective shaped by cities, merchants, rationality, and time, paved the way for ‘new man’ of the Renaissance.

Abstract A public Islamic intellectual is a person who takes up matters of public concern from an Islamic perspective. The influence of public Islamic intellectuals has grown in Turkey in the last 30 years. This chapter explores public Islamic intellectuals in Turkey by focusing on prominent examples like Yaşar Nuri Öztürk, İlhami Güler, Mustafa İslamoğlu, Ebubekir Sifil, and Hayrettin Karaman. It first defines the various religious perspectives to which they adhere. It then studies each perspective by analyzing it in terms of methodology, argument, and perspectives on popular issues, from politics to Islamic law. The chapter also explains their positions along the political spectrum. This part aims to disclose why several of them have transformed into public dissidents, while others have stayed loyal to the government. The discussion in this chapter will help readers understand how public Islamic intellectuals in Turkey are similar yet differentiated in terms of methodology, intellectual tradition, and political views.

Based on data from 196,622 UPOV member applications between 2011 and 2021, this study examined the landscape trend and evolution rule of new plant varieties protection worldwide. The findings indicate that international attention to new plant varieties is increasing. Both the number of innovations and the landscape of overseas new plant varieties are polarized, with developed countries being the main occupying subjects, and developing countries mostly serving as market subjects. The owner's landscape strategy gradually is increasingly spreading intellectual property rights to the market.

Bagehot is difficult for modern economists to read with understanding, for three reasons. He was a classical economist not neoclassical, his orientation was global not national, and, most importantly, his intellectual formation was as a practicing country banker not an academic. This paper adopts all three perspectives, and uses this frame to reinterpret his mature work, both Lombard Street and the unfinished Economic Studies, as the origin of the key currency tradition which continues as a minority view in modern economics.
